Why does the Mac spinning wheel of death appear? It usually takes about 4 seconds for the app to decide that it’s non-responsive. When an app receives more events than it can process, the window server automatically shows you the spinning ball. The ball signifies that your Mac cannot handle all the tasks given to it at this moment.Įvery app on your Mac has a so-called window server. It’s official name is the Spinning Wait Cursor, not so official - the Spinning Beach Ball of Death or SBBOD.
